Periodically, for no apparent reason, my discussion web will start to add
comments from other questions onto the bottom of the answer to another
question. Once this starts, everything from then on is corrupted.

I usually have to trash the whole thing and start over by copying and
pasting everything on there to a new DW. I am sick of this.

Why is this happening? And is there any way to fix this without having to
start over?

Make sure it is setup in a subweb, so that when you publish, it is not being overwritten with your
local copy.
